发明名称 Using dynamic object modeling and business rules to dynamically specify and modify behavior
摘要 A system and a method are provided for using dynamic object modeling and one or more types of policy rules to dynamically specify and modify system behavior at various levels of abstraction, including business, system, and device implementation. The system and method allow for specifying, instantiating, managing, and removing sets of temporary or permanent additions and/or modifications to the attributes or behavior of a set of objects, relationships, scripts, and/or applications of a device, module, subsystem, or system, without having to change the underlying code of these objects, relationships, scripts, and/or applications. The systems and methods enable attributes, methods and/or relationships (e.g., associations, aggregations, and/or compositions), as well as constraints on any of these elements, to be dynamically added or changed at runtime without changing any underlying code of the components being managed by instantiating and manipulating object instances in accordance with certain policy rules.
申请公布号 US9460417(B2) 申请公布日期 2016.10.04
申请号 US201313916993 申请日期 2013.06.13
申请人 Futurewei Technologies, Inc. 发明人 Strassner John
分类号 G06F15/177;G06Q10/10;G06Q10/06 主分类号 G06F15/177
代理机构 Schwegman Lundberg & Woessner, P.A. 代理人 Schwegman Lundberg & Woessner, P.A.
主权项 1. A method for specifying the features and behavior of a set of system resources, wherein the method comprises: providing a management entity having a processor and a memory; providing an information model to represent features, behaviors, or relationships of a set of system resources, wherein said information model includes a first set of model elements; deriving, by the management entity, a data model from the information model, wherein the deriving comprises mapping one or more elements of the first set of model elements into a second set of model elements of the data model; storing the data model into a first repository; deriving, by the management entity, one or more data objects from the data model associated with a behavior, feature, or relationship of a system resource; and executing, by the management entity, one or more process to effect one or more system changes specified by the one or more data objects.
地址 Plano TX US